Unlock CHIRP Excellence Across Dual Bands
At its core, this transducer shines with dual-band CHIRP operation: a low-frequency sweep from 42-65 kHz paired with a medium band of 85-135 kHz. Why does this matter? Traditional fixed-frequency sonar often misses the nuances, but CHIRP pulses a continuous range of frequencies, delivering sharper fish arches, tighter bottom detail, and fewer dropouts in rough conditions. The low band casts a wider net—16-25 degrees beamwidth—for scanning vast bluewater expanses, while the medium band narrows to 6-10 degrees for surgical precision on wrecks and reefs.
Spanning 73 kHz total bandwidth, it effortlessly hits sweet spots like 50 kHz for deep pelagics, 88 kHz for mid-depth bait balls, and 107 kHz for high-res structure work. Built for the Demands of Fiberglass Hulls
Crafted from durable bronze, this pocket-mount design slots seamlessly into fiberglass hulls, minimizing drag and maximizing signal integrity. Unlike flush thru-hulls, pocket mounts hug the keel line for optimal forward-facing performance, ideal for planing hulls that pound through chop. Its fast-response temperature sensor keeps you dialed into water column shifts, helping predict fish movements during dawn patrols or upwelling events.

Smart Installation for Peak Performance
Success starts with placement: aim for a fairing that aligns the transducer perpendicular to the waterline at speed, typically 12-18 inches off centerline to dodge prop wash. Bronze construction resists corrosion, but always bed in a non-conductive sealant to prevent electrolysis. Calibrate post-install for your hull speed—running 20-30 knots reveals any air bubble interference, tweakable with minimal tools.
Pro tip: In variable deadrise hulls, a custom wedge ensures the beam stays vertical, boosting target separation by 20-30%. Maintenance is straightforward—annual freshwater rinses and anode checks keep it humming season after season.
